Understanding French Door Windows: Elegance Meets Functionality

French door windows have actually ended up being associated with timeless sophistication and practical style in contemporary architecture and home restorations. These classy structures offer not just visual appeal but likewise performance by allowing ample light and fluidity in between spaces. This post explores the numerous elements of French door windows, including their types, benefits, installation considerations, maintenance, and frequently asked questions.

What are French Door Windows?

French door windows are typically identified by their dual-door style, including a series of glass panes that offer an unblocked view and simple access to outdoor spaces. While traditional French doors are hinged, modern-day models often can be found in sliding or bi-fold configurations. These doors can be utilized in numerous settings, consisting of patio areas, gardens, and even inside to separate different living areas.

Table 1: Comparison of French Door Styles

DesignDescriptionProsCons
Hinged French DoorsDoors that open outside or inward when unlatched.Stylish look; classic style.Requires clearance space for opening.
Sliding French DoorsDoors glide along a track rather than opening outwards.Space-saving; easier for high traffic.Might have a lower aesthetic appeal.
Bi-fold French DoorsMultiple panels that fold and stack to one side.Optimizes opening, terrific for access.Can be more costly; requires more space.

Benefits of French Door Windows

French door windows come with a plethora of advantages that make them an appealing option for homeowners:

  1. Natural Light: The comprehensive glass design welcomes natural light into the home, brightening rooms and minimizing the need for synthetic lighting.
  2. Visual Appeal: Their timeless style improves the aesthetic of a home, adding sophistication and sophistication. They can become a centerpiece in foyers, dining spaces, or living areas.
  3. Increased Ventilation: French doors can be opened completely to supply outstanding cross-ventilation, decreasing indoor humidity and improving air quality.
  4. Versatility: They can be used in a variety of places, such as patio areas, balconies, gardens, or as interior dividers.
  5. Increased Property Value: The addition of French door windows can increase the appeal of a property, making it more appealing to prospective buyers.

Popular French Door Window Materials

French doors can be made from a variety of materials, each of which has its own unique features:

  • Wood: Traditional choice known for its charm and insulation properties. Nevertheless, wood needs routine upkeep.
  • Vinyl: Low upkeep with excellent energy effectiveness. Offered in different colors and designs but typically less traditional in look.
  • Aluminum: Durable and resistant to weather, allowing for large panes of glass. Nevertheless, they perform heat, so they may not be as energy-efficient.
  • Fiberglass: Offers the look of wood but with low upkeep. It's energy-efficient and resistant to warping.

Setup Considerations

When preparing to set up French door windows, numerous elements ought to be taken into account:

  1. Space: Ensure that there is adequate area for the style picked, particularly for hinged or bi-fold doors that require clearance for opening.
  2. Design and style: Consider the architectural design of the home and pick a style that complements it.
  3. Energy Efficiency: Look for doors with double glazing and high-quality seals to reduce energy loss.
  4. Local Climate: Some door products perform much better in specific climates. For instance, wood might swell in humid conditions, while aluminum is more matched for coastal locations.
  5. Expert Help: Installation might need professional know-how, specifically if structural modifications are required.

Maintenance of French Door Windows

Preserving French door windows is important to guarantee their longevity and optimum efficiency. Here are some maintenance tips:

  • Regular Cleaning: Clean the glass and frames routinely using mild soap and water to remove dirt, gunk, and finger prints.
  • Inspect Seals: Inspect seals and weather-stripping occasionally to prevent leakages and drafts.
  • Paint or Stain: If made from wood, frequently repaint or stain the surfaces to secure versus weathering.
  • Hardware Inspection: Ensure hinges, handles, and locking mechanisms remain in good working condition and lubricate them when needed.

Often Asked Questions (FAQs)

1. Are French doors energy effective?

Yes, lots of modern French doors featured energy-efficient functions like double or triple glazing, which assists to lessen heat loss and UV direct exposure.

2. Just how much do French door windows cost?

The expense can differ commonly depending on design, product, and installation complexities. Standard models may begin around ₤ 500 per door, while custom-built or high-end alternatives can surpass ₤ 2,000.

3. Can French doors be installed in existing walls?

Yes, French doors can be installed in existing walls, but it frequently needs structural adjustments. Working with an expert specialist is suggested for such projects.

4. Are French doors secure?

While some people may assume French doors are less secure, manufacturers offer strengthened glass and lock systems that can enhance security.

5. Can French doors be used indoors?

Absolutely! French doors can work as stylish room dividers, including character and supplying sight lines in between spaces while maintaining a boundary.
